The first step in lawn care is mowing. In neighborhoods like Whispering Pines and SouthPark, where the outdoor landscape is a point of pride, it's essential to mow your lawn regularly. Mowing should be a weekly task during the spring and summer months when the grass grows the fastest. Always remember to keep your mower blades sharp and never cut more than one-third of the grass blade at a time. This helps to maintain a healthy and thick lawn, which will be more resistant to weeds, disease, and drought.

Next, fertilizing and seeding should be done at specific times of the year. The best time to fertilize your lawn in Littleton is in the early spring and fall. This aligns with the growth cycle of the grass, allowing it to absorb nutrients when it needs them most. Seeding, on the other hand, should be done in the fall. This gives the new grass time to establish roots before the cold winter months.

Watering is another essential aspect of lawn care in Littleton. Due to our dry climate, it's vital to water your lawn deeply and infrequently. This encourages deep root growth, which helps your lawn to better survive drought conditions. Aim to water your lawn early in the morning to reduce evaporation. Always be mindful of any water restrictions that may be in place, especially during the hotter months.

Lastly, aerating and dethatching your lawn can significantly improve its health and appearance. Aeration should be done in the spring and fall, while dethatching is best done in the early spring. These processes help to break up compacted soil, allowing water, nutrients, and air to reach the grass roots more effectively.

Remember, the type of soil in your lawn plays a crucial role in its care. Littleton's soil tends to be clayey, which means it retains water well but can become compacted easily. Therefore, regular aeration is beneficial.
